About This Property
This is a rare opportunity to live in a condo unit at The Terraces of Morningside Hills. Most units are owner occupied. Rental comes with an outdoor in ground pool. This 1 bedroom upper unit Condo has it's own 1.5 attached garage. Other amenities include: New living room carpeting, luxury vinyl flooring, new stove (not shown in pictures), refrigerator, built in microwave above the stove, dishwasher, garbage disposal, air conditioner, washer and dryer (off of kitchen), storage locker in basement, attached garage plus one out door parking space, balcony, and water. Requires 1 year lease, no smoking Sorry no pets! Upon application please provide 2 forms of ID, and bill with current address, a months of check stubs or current income, and a credit report (or a credit report can be done for you for a fee).

Welcome to Waukesha, Wisconsin, a historic community 18 miles west of Milwaukee. Originally known as "Spring City" for its mineral springs, Waukesha combines well-preserved architecture with contemporary living options. The downtown area showcases the impressive Waukesha County Courthouse complex, while the Fox River provides walking trails and outdoor recreation spaces. Current rental trends show moderate growth, with one-bedroom apartments averaging $1,219 monthly and experiencing a 2.9% annual increase, while two-bedroom units typically rent for $1,497.
Carroll University anchors the community's educational landscape, while the downtown district features independent shops and restaurants alongside regular community events. Housing options include apartment communities near The Shoppes at Fox River and residential properties in the Dunbar Oaks area. Frame Park offers riverside walking paths, and Minooka Park provides extensive trails for outdoor recreation.
